What is a remote data analyst French?

A Remote Data Analyst French is a professional who analyzes data and extracts insights while working from a remote location, with a focus on projects or organizations that require fluency in French. Their responsibilities typically involve collecting, cleaning, and interpreting data, preparing reports, and offering actionable recommendations. They may work for international companies, research organizations, or any business that operates in French-speaking markets. Strong analytical skills, proficiency in data analysis tools, and fluency in both French and English are essential for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ote data analyst French?

To thrive as a Remote Data Analyst (French), you need strong analytical abilities, proficiency in data interpretation, and fluency in both French and English, typically supported by a degree in statistics, mathematics, or a related field. Familiarity with data analytics tools like SQL, Excel, Python, and business intelligence platforms such as Tableau or Power BI is important, and certifications in data analysis or analytics can be beneficial. Excellent communication, attention to detail, and the ability to work independently and cross-culturally are standout soft skills for this remote, bilingual position. These competencies ensure accurate data-driven insights, clear reporting for French-speaking stakeholders, and effective collaboration in a distributed work environment.

How does a remote data analyst French typically collaborate with international teams while working from home?

A Remote Data Analyst French often works with colleagues from various countries, leveraging digital communication tools like Slack, Microsoft Teams, and Zoom for effective collaboration. Regular virtual meetings and shared project management platforms help align on goals, share insights, and discuss findings. Since the role often involves analyzing data from French-speaking markets, clear documentation and bilingual communication are essential for coordinating with both local and global stakeholders. Being proactive in sharing updates and asking questions helps bridge any gaps caused by remote work and time zone differences.

Job description

IAT Insurance Group has an immediate opening for a Business Analyst from our Milwaukee, Wisconsin or Naperville, Illinois locations. This position works closely with Business Solutions Leads, Architects, and other key IT resources to drive the planning and definition of new technology solutions and enhancements to existing solutions.

This role works a hybrid schedule that requires working from the office Monday through Wednesday, with the option of working Thursday and Friday remotely.

While we prefer candidates to work from one of our IAT office locations, we are open to considering fully remote arrangements for the ideal candidate.

Responsibilities:

  • Elicit, analyze, and document business and data requirements from stakeholders across the insurance organization.
  • Translate business needs into clear functional specifications, source-to-target mappings, and user stories for data and reporting solutions.
  • Profile, validate, and analyze data by writing SQL queries against source systems and the Insights warehouse.
  • Interpret Duck Creek policy XML data structures and map these to Insights staging tables and columns.
  • Partner with developers and data engineers to ensure delivered solutions meet documented requirements.
  • Facilitate stakeholder meetings, present findings, and produce documentation tailored to techn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Support data quality, governance, and reporting initiatives within the Data Management organization.
  • Assist support team in analysis of data issues.
  • Perform other duties as needed.

Qualifications:

Must Have:

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or similar technology-related field with 2+ years of related experience
  • In lieu of a bachelor's degree and 2 years of experience, we will consider a candidate with 7+ years of related experience
  • Demonstrated experience as a Business Analyst, with proven requirements-gathering and process-analysis skills.
  • Hands-on knowledge of the Duck Creek Policy platform.
  • Knowledgeable in Extract Mapper tool from Duck Creek.
  • Working knowledge of the Duck Creek Insights data warehouse.
  • Significant experience in the P&C insurance industry.
  • Proficiency in writing SQL queries for data analysis and validation.
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ills.
  • To qualify, all applicants must be authorized to work in the United States and must not require, now or in the future, VISA sponsorship for employment purposes.

Preferred to Have:

  • P & C Insurance experience
  • Familiarity with bureau / statistical reporting and insurance regulatory data.
  • Exposure to Agile delivery and tools such as Azure DevOps or Jira.
  • Bachelor's degree in business, Information Systems, or a related field, or equivalent experience.
